Traditional Vietnamese Herbal Therapies
Vietnamese wellness traditions often use locally grown herbs, medicinal plants and natural oils. These therapies differ from Thai or Balinese massage because they focus more on gentle healing and circulation.
Popular treatments include:
-
Herbal steam baths
-
Lemongrass therapy
-
Ginger compress massage
-
Vietnamese bamboo massage
-
Herbal foot therapy
Northern mountain regions are especially famous for herbal healing traditions.

How to Plan a Vietnam Luxury Spa Retreat
Best Time to Visit
Vietnam’s climate varies significantly by region.
North Vietnam
Best for wellness travel:
-
October to April
Central Vietnam
Best for beach wellness:
-
February to August
South Vietnam
Best for island escapes:
-
November to April
Travelers planning multi-region wellness trips should consider seasonal differences carefully.
How Long Should You Stay?
For meaningful wellness benefits, most travelers should plan:
-
5 to 7 days for one retreat
-
10 to 14 days for a multi-destination journey
Short spa weekends are enjoyable, but longer stays allow deeper recovery and relaxation.
